$Author: ronalde $ - $Date: 2005-05-18 14:23:29 +0100 (Wed, 18 May 2005) $ - $Rev: 29 $ csCSSc - Client-side CSS (De)Compressor This tool is developed by datube and may be used online on http://www.automotivecenter.nl/diversen/utility/csscompressor The tool is a HTML-page with a Java-/ECMA-script file and serves the following purposes: - Compress CSS-code to save bandwidth by removing unnecessary white-space characters from CSS code - Decompress/pretty print CSS-code for readability and maintainability of the CSS-code The typed or pasted CSS-code should be valid CSS Level 1 and/or 2 code. Features of the compressor Currently the script performs the following actions on valid CSS-code: - Optionally, remove all comments All CSS comment-instructions can be removed, eg. everything between `/*' and `*/'. - Remove unnecessary white-space All unnecessary white-space characters are removed. Additionaly, one may choose to remove all newline characters as well, resulting in a single-line file. - Remove unnecessary value-types When a value of a property equals `0' (zero), the compressor will remove type-declarations from the value, like `px' and `em'.
